[td] : [/td][td]Visa Office. For processing times, see "Processing times for federal skilled worker applications" on CIC website. CIC explained that "Citizenship and Immigration Canada (CIC) calculates processing times from the day CIC receives an application to the day it makes a decision on the application.". More details can be shown in Help Centre on CIC.

[/td]

[tr][td]PER[/td][td] : [/td][td]Positive Eligibility Review - An email which shows your file number and so on. It will be sent from CIO if your application passes the initial eligibility review. See the other thread titled "What is PER" for more details.[/td][/tr]

Jaz you do not need a file number to check your e-CAS status. You can request information just by giving your Client UID (8-digit number ID for immigration), your Surname, Date of Birth and Place of Birth.
